One of the most important skill sets for people in my field is teamwork and few courses or research experiences are successful in developing this. Would be amazing to redirect with coteaching, team-building and problem-solving in a wider array of courses.
The most important thing universities should do in a world with AI is to greatly increase the number of professors, so that classes can be smaller and more class time can be spent directly interacting with students as people.

Implementing the station rotation model in a co-teaching classroom offers significant benefits, from creating a more inclusive environment to increasing opportunities for differentiated & personalized instruction: bit.ly/3TdiGh9
